Sexual accusations or claims are unfortunate but often arise in life. It could be against you or you could be making the claim. Expert sex crimes attorney Phoenix states that such a case should not be taken lightly. For the claim to be successful or in order to mount a solid defense, you need to take certain precautions and fulfill certain obligations.

Preserve all evidence possible from the scene or encounter. This ranges from soiled cloths to pictures or messages sent or received. This will prove the case against or for you and eliminate instances of doubt or misinformation. Courts highly rely on evidence which is weightier than plain claims. Accusers can make insinuations and innuendos aimed at disadvantaging you. Only evidence will get you off the hook. Keep it safe until it has been seen and adapted by the court.

Seek immediate and quality medical attention. Sexual assault cases might come with injuries, trauma and infections that aggravate the situation. Infections are better handled as soon as possible. The judge will consider that you sort to defend yourself by seeking immediate medical attention. This will affect the amount you receive as compensation. Do not prioritize the legal battle instead but pay more attention to your health. Ensure that any treatment is documented and does not injuriously tamper with evidence.

Make a formal claim to the police before going to the lawyer. Courts look for formalized complaints because police are given investigative powers. They also document incidences without bias. This makes their evidence more powerful and therefore admissible in a court of law. The court may dispute your claim as an opinion but will give a lot of weight to a report given by a civil authority like the police.

All records relating to the assault or claim must be preserved and presented to the court. These records include pictures of the scene, receipts of medical attention sort, police report records and any other document that provides proof of your position. The records will determine whether the case is decided in your favor or against you. The records are also weightier than an oral statement by the victim.

An experienced and specialist attorney will increase chances of a favorable judgment. Law is a very wide subject such that one person cannot master in entirety. Specialists in sexual assault increase your chances of winning because they understand the dynamics of such a case. They will also be authoritative when making a claim.

View the case holistically instead of concentrating on the sexual assault. There are civil claims that accompany such cases. Victims also make claims for psychological torture and unwarranted exposure to negative publicity. The contribution of the accuser will also be considered when a person is filing a claim. These facts will affect the outcome, either swinging the case to your favor or against you.

Do not hurry to settle a case or sign documents whose content is unknown to you. Always consult a lawyer to ensure that your rights are not trampled upon. An experienced and specialist lawyer also ensures that you get the compensation that is deserved without humiliation or intimidation. He will also ensure that your dignity is preserved throughout the prosecution process.
